Concord Hospital-Franklin is a non-profit, Critical Access hospital located in Franklin, New Hampshire, a mid-size city setting that may offer a welcoming community for international nurses. While the hospital has not yet hired international nurses, its history of EB3 sponsorship suggests potential openness to international applicants. The supportive environment of a mid-size city and the hospital’s non-profit status may appeal to those seeking a community-focused workplace.
